+md5.lua [![Build Status](https://travis-ci.org/kikito/md5.lua.svg)](https://travis-ci.org/kikito/md5.lua)
+=========================================================================================================
+
+This pure-Lua module computes md5 in Lua 5.1, Lua 5.2 and LuaJIT, using native bit-manipulation libraries when available, and falling back to table-based manipulation of integers in 5.1.
+
+It implements md5.sum and md5.sumhex like the [kernel project md5 package](http://www.keplerproject.org/md5/), but it's done completely in Lua, with no dependencies on other libs or C files.
+
+Usage
+=====
+
+Simple example:
+
+ local md5 = require 'md5'
+
+ local md5_as_data = md5.sum(message) -- returns raw bytes
+ local md5_as_hex = md5.sumhexa(message) -- returns a hex string
+ local md5_as_hex2 = md5.tohex(md5_as_data) -- returns the same string as md5_as_hex
+
+Incremental example (for computing md5 of streams, or big files which have to be loaded in chunks - new since 1.1.0):
+
+ local m = md5.new()
+ m:update('some bytes')
+ m:update('some more bytes')
+ m:update('etc')
+ return md5.tohex(m:finish())

+Credits
+=======
+
+This is a cleanup of an implementation by Adam Baldwin - https://gist.github.com/evilpacket/3647908
+
+Which in turn was a mix of the bitwise lib, http://luaforge.net/projects/bit/ by hanzhao (`abrash_han - at - hotmail.com`),
+and http://equi4.com/md5/md5calc.lua, by Equi 4 Software.
+
+Lua 5.2 and LuaJIT compatibility by [Positive07](https://github.com/kikito/md5.lua/pull/2)
+
+A very important fix and the incremental variant by [pgimeno](https://github.com/kikito/md5.lua/pull/10)

+Specs
+=====
+
+The specs for this library are implemented with [busted](http://ovinelabs.com/busted/). In order to run them, install busted and then:
+
+ cd path/to/where/the/spec/folder/is
+ busted
+
+Install
+=======
+
+Either copy the file or using luarocks:
+
+ luarocks install --server=http://luarocks.org/manifests/kikito md5
